https://blog.csdn.net/jesse621/article/details/9452049 触发器,简洁,存储过程,明了 使用 触发器的作用: 触发器的主要作用是其能够实现由主键和外键所不能保证的复杂的参照完整性和数据的一致性。它能够对数据库中的相关表进行级联修改,强制比CHECK ...
分类:
其他好文 时间:
2019-11-09 09:28:27
阅读次数:
123
数据库的完整性 数据库约束是保证数据库完整性的方法 ,数据库完整性分为实体完整性、域完整性和参照完整性 实体完整性 实体完整性要求表中的主键字段不能为空且不能重复; 域完整性 域完整性要求表中数据都在有效范围内; 参照完整性 参照完整性保证了相关联的表的数据一致性; 约束的使用 约束是保证表中数据完 ...
分类:
数据库 时间:
2019-10-03 13:00:32
阅读次数:
108
关系的完整性约束 实体完整性: 主键不为空 参照完整性: 或为空, 或者等于另一个关系的主码值 用户定义完整性: 用于设置某个属性的取值范围 SQL即Structured Query Language DDL(Data Definition Language数据定义语言) 用来建立数据库、数据库对象 ...
分类:
数据库 时间:
2019-09-10 23:57:36
阅读次数:
204
一、外键简介 外键表示一个表中的一个字段被另一个表中的一个字段引用。外键对相关表中的数据造成了限制,使MySQL能够保持参照完整性。 下面来看看示例数据库(yiibaidb)中的以下数据库中两个表:customers和`orders``的ER图。 上图中有两张表:customers和orders。每 ...
分类:
数据库 时间:
2019-09-03 18:06:58
阅读次数:
116
我想在django模型中设置一个ForeignKey字段,它在某些时候指向另一个表.但我希望可以在这个字段中插入一个id,它引用另一个表中可能不存在的条目.因此,如果该行存在于另一个表中,我希望获得ForeignKey关系的所有好处.但如果没有,我希望这只被视为一个数字. 这可能吗?这是通用关系的用 ...
分类:
其他好文 时间:
2019-09-02 11:48:51
阅读次数:
106
物理抽象、概念抽象、视图级抽象,内模式、模式、外模式 实体完整性、域完整性、参照完整性、用户定义完整性 l 超键:在关系中能唯一标识元组的属性集称为关系模式的超键。一个属性可以作为超键,多个属性组合在一起也可以作为一个超键。超键包含候选键和主键。 l 候选键:不含有任何多余属性的超键称为候选键。 l ...
分类:
数据库 时间:
2019-08-19 13:11:01
阅读次数:
107
什么是myisam引擎 myisam引擎是MySQL关系数据库系统的默认储存引擎(mysql 5.5.5之前)。这种MySQL表存储结构从旧的ISAM代码扩展出许多有用的功能。在新版本的Mysql中,Innodb引擎由于其对事务参照完整性,以及更高的并发性等优点开始逐步取代Myisam引擎。 每一个 ...
分类:
其他好文 时间:
2019-07-08 12:06:24
阅读次数:
307
约束 数据完整性 constraint 实体完整性保证表中有一个主键,还可以编写触发器保证数据完整性 域完整性保证数据每列的值满足特定条件,可以通过一下途径来保证: 选择适合的数据类型,外键,编写触发器,还可以用default 约束作为强制域完整性的一个方面 参照完整性保证两张表之间的关系 约束的创 ...
分类:
数据库 时间:
2019-05-05 01:28:53
阅读次数:
193
6.5 事务实现原理之1:Redo Log 介绍事务怎么用后,下面探讨事务的实现原理。事务有ACID四个核心属性:A:原子性。事务要么不执行,要么完全执行。如果执行到一半,宕机重启,已执行的一半要回滚回去。C:一致性。各种约束条件,比如主键不能为空、参照完整性等。I:隔离性。隔离性和并发性密切相关, ...
分类:
数据库 时间:
2019-04-12 14:55:08
阅读次数:
222
一.介绍 为什么有索引:使用索引可快速访问数据库表中的特定信息。索引是对数据库表中一列或多列的值进行排序的一种结构. 作用: 1. 快速查询数据 2. 保证数据的唯一性 3. 实现表与表之间的参照完整性 4. 在使用order by、group by子句进行数据检索时,利用索引可以减少排序和分组的时 ...
分类:
数据库 时间:
2019-01-25 21:45:47
阅读次数:
151